description 碩士 === 國立彰化師範大學 === 工業教育與技術學系 === 93 === Abstract This research aims to construct indicators of the core competency for secondary school principals, so as to understand to what extent incumbent principals show self-consciousness toward their own core competency. Consequently it can then be possible to put forth suggestions on designation, training and professional development of secondary school principals. In the first phase of this study in order to design a questionnaire for the core competency of secondary school principals, the Modified Delphi Method was used to inquire 12 experts about the core competency of secondary school principals, followed by the Kalmogorov-smirnov one sample test. In the second phase the technique of proportional stratified random sampling was used. Among 54% of the public and private secondary schools in Taiwan, a total of 185 principals were selected to participate in the research. From the analysis of the data, the implications are as follows: a. The core competency of secondary school principals should include competency in 4 domains: educational profession, administrative management ability, public relation dealing ability and personality. b. The secondary school principals believe that the 4 domains mentioned above are all very important, and that they have already acquired them to a certain extent. The domain that the principals believe themselves to have developed the most is “personality”, in which they regard the most important elements to be: A. Professional ethics and morality. B. The ability to lead and inspire a team. C. Being aggressive and energetic. D. The ability to communicate and negotiate. E. The ability to plan school’s future visions. F. The ability to transform and deal with crises. c. Principals from different backgrounds show significant differences in their self-consciousness toward core competency; especially on the variables of education and schools in which their work. It can be helpful if the educational administrative authority can build an indicator system of the core competency for secondary school principals. In addition, a special training program for private secondary school principals with a lack of professional education can help them develop professional core competency.
